Climate Change Response

Strategies and Action Plans for a Sustainable Future

The Company recognizes the impacts of climate change and increasingly stringent regulatory trends from participation in global cooperation frameworks. Therefore, environmental policies and practices have been established focusing on efficient energy use, greenhouse gas emission reduction, and climate risk management to create value for the organization and stakeholders while setting long-term operational goals.

Environmental Goals

Net Zero

Net Zero Greenhouse Gas Emissions Target

By 2050

20%

Reduce Scope 1-2 GHG Emissions

By 2027

50%

Clean Energy Usage in Warehouse Operations

By 2027

Climate Change Response Strategies

Reduce GHG Emissions from Fossil Fuel Combustion and Air Pollution in Operating Areas

The Company aims to reduce dependence on fossil fuels by promoting alternative energy and high-efficiency equipment to reduce greenhouse gas (GHG) emissions as well as air pollutants such as particulate matter (PM) and toxic gases, which helps improve air quality both within and around operating areas, as well as reduce impacts on employee health and surrounding communities.

Reduce Noise Pollution, Creating a Safer and More Suitable Working Environment

The Company prioritizes controlling noise levels from machinery and operational activities by selecting low-noise equipment and improving work processes to reduce noise sources, which helps reduce hearing health risks for employees, reduces communication barriers during work, and creates a working environment conducive to efficiency.

Enhance Cargo Handling Efficiency with Electric Forklift Technology for Precise and Consistent Operations

The Company has adopted electric forklift technology to replace internal combustion engine forklifts to reduce pollution emissions and increase operational efficiency. Electric forklifts can precisely control movement and cargo lifting, reducing cargo damage, operational errors, and ensuring continuous and standardized handling processes.

Optimize Transportation Routes through Efficient Logistics Management (Route Optimization) to Reduce Unnecessary Energy Use

The Company applies route analysis and planning systems (Route Optimization) to select the most suitable routes in terms of distance, time, and traffic conditions, helping reduce redundant distances, lower fuel consumption, and reduce greenhouse gas emissions from transportation. Additionally, it helps improve delivery punctuality and reduce overall logistics costs.
